Output 39d1ce5a87ce871a6ddb1461e6fca9b0601372c626d5b2f311905c97f95daabb:21

value
172066509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e5a0fe19d3da429e8c692e9862ffce9a17f30d3 OP_EQUAL
address
38qJX8HrN5iUH46mB5gRWiSMrzN7qnnniZ
transaction
39d1ce5a87ce871a6ddb1461e6fca9b0601372c626d5b2f311905c97f95daabb
confirmations
285552
spent
true